Julius Berger’s annual profit slumps by 86.79%

Julius Berger Nigeria Plc has reported a profit of N1.36 billion for the 2020 financial year, down from N10.30 billion in the previous year.

Its revenue fell to N242.46 billion last year from N264.56 billion in 2019, according to its unaudited financial statements obtained by MarketsReporters from the Nigerian Stock Exchange.

The construction company said its profit before tax dropped to N4.12 billion from N14.68 billion year-on-year.

It said the COVID-19 pandemic started to impact on its operations from the middle of March 2020.

“Following governmental regulations on COVID-19, a shutdown of business activities has been carried out between March and May 2020. After a phased and gradual easing of the lockdown, operations across all Julius Berge sites and subsidiaries have resumed,” it said.

Julius Berger said the costs for demobilisation and remobilisation of construction sites were included in the cost of sales in the fourth quarter of 2020.
